Transaction

0645a8731d759e118f0057d735cc3f5cf880baa2d948fee4606d4f312bb063e2

Summary

In Block636112
TimeMon, 01 Apr 2024 03:29:00 UTC
Total Input699.6827118 Nebula
Total Output733.6827118 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
314024 Confirmations733.6827118 Nebula
Raw Transaction